프로토콜://도메인/경로
ㄴ도메인 : 웹상에서 고유 식별자로 사용되는 웹 사이트의 주소. 사이트의 이름과 최상위 도메인(Top-Level Domain)으로 구성 (.com.org등)
ㄴ경로 : 웹 사이트 내 특정 페이지나 파일의 위치를 지정.
ㄴ'/'로 구분된 디렉토리 경로와 파일명으로 구성.
https : 프로토콜 중 하나
ㄴhttp's'<- security 보안강화
GitHub란? 개발자들이 사용하는 코드 저장소.
ㄴ자신의 코드를 저장하고 다른 사람들과 공유하는 곳.
GitHub - Start a new repositoryㄴ프로젝트명 입력ㄴPublicㄴCreate a new repository
-uploading an existing fileㄴ파일 선택ㄴCommit changes-Settignsㄴpagesㄴnone->main-save-쪼금 기다려보자.
***깃허브에 페이지 업로드를 할 땐 파일명이 'index.html'인지, 소문자인지 꼭 확인!!!***
-깃허브에 올린 파일 수정
ㄴ1. 기존 파일을 지우고 새로올리기
ㄴ2. 기존 파일을 edit place 누르고 수정
FirebaseDB
ㄴ커스터마이징하기 어렵다.
ㄴ단순히 저장하고 받아오기 정도.
ㄴ구글 서비스에 의존해야한다.
웹개발->서버만들기
Python - 파이썬으로 서버만들기 관심 가져보자♡
ㄴ라이브러리가 잘 되어있다
Colab
ㄴ파이썬으로 데이터 분석을 할 때 연구자들이 활용하는 툴
-파일ㄴ새노트-print('hello world')-ctrl+enter
==크롤링(스크래핑)기본 세팅==
import requests
from bs4 import BeautifulSoup
URL = "https://movie.daum.net/ranking/reservation"
headers = {'User-Agent' : 'Mozilla/5.0 (Windows NT 10.0; Win64; x64)AppleWebKit/537.36 (KHTML, like Gecko) Chrome/73.0.3683.86 Safari/537.36'}
data = requests.get(URL, headers=headers)
soup = BeautifulSoup(data.text, 'html.parser')
==========
??? : 코딩 또한 반복숙달이더라~
ㄴ코드 꾸러미를 이해하는게 중요하더라~
"+?x.x?y"
'코딩 > 웹개발 A to Z' 카테고리의 다른 글
웹 개발 A to Z - 4주차 (0) | 2023.10.10 |
---|---|
웹 개발 A to Z - 3주차 (0) | 2023.10.10 |
웹 개발 A to Z - 2주차 (0) | 2023.10.10 |
웹 개발 A to Z - 1주차 (1) | 2023.10.10 |